# Changes in version 0.7.0
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
This is a stable bugfix and feature release.  Major new features and changes include: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Add `ZSH_HIGHLIGHT_DIRS_BLACKLIST` to disable "path" and "path prefix"
 | 
						|
  highlighting for specific directories
 | 
						|
  [#379]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Add the "regexp" highlighter, modelled after the pattern highlighter
 | 
						|
  [4e6f60063f1c]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- When a word uses globbing, only the globbing metacharacters will be highlighted as globbing:
 | 
						|
  in `: foo*bar`, only the `*` will be blue.
 | 
						|
  [e48af357532c]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ight pasted quotes (e.g., `: foo"bar"`)
 | 
						|
  [dc1b2f6fa4bb]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ight command substitutions (`` : `ls` ``, `: $(ls)`)
 | 
						|
  [c0e64fe13178 and parents, e86f75a840e7, et al]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ight process substitutions (`: >(nl)`, `: <(pwd)`, `: =(git diff)`)
 | 
						|
  [c0e64fe13178 and parents, e86f75a840e7, et al]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ight command substitutions inside double quotes (``: "`foo`"``)
 | 
						|
  [f16e858f0c83]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ight many precommands (e.g., `nice`, `stdbuf`, `eatmydata`;
 | 
						|
  see `$precommand_options` in the source)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ight numeric globs (e.g., `echo /lib<->`)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Assorted improvement to aliases highlighting
 | 
						|
  (e.g.,
 | 
						|
   `alias sudo_u='sudo -u'; sudo_u jrandom ls`,
 | 
						|
   `alias x=y y=z z=nosuchcommand; x`,
 | 
						|
   `alias ls='ls -l'; \ls`)
 | 
						|
  [f3410c5862fc, 57386f30aec8, #544, and many others]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ight some more syntax errors
 | 
						|
  [dea05e44e671, 298ef6a2fa30]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- New styles: named file descriptors, `RC_QUOTES`, and unclosed quotes (e.g., `echo "foo<CURSOR>`)
 | 
						|
  [38c794a978cd, 25ae1c01216c, 967335dfc5fd]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- The 'brackets' highlighting no longer treats quotes specially.
 | 
						|
  [ecdda36ef56f]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
Selected bugfixes include: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Highlight `sudo` correctly when it's not installed
 | 
						|
  [26a82113b08b]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Handle some non-default options being set in zshrc
 | 
						|
  [b07ada1255b7, a2a899b41b8, 972ad197c13d, b3f66fc8748f]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Fix off-by-one highlighting in vi "visual" mode (vicmd keymap)
 | 
						|
  [be3882aeb054]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- The 'yank-pop' widget is not wrapped
 | 
						|
  [#183]
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
Known issues include: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- A multiline alias that uses a simple command terminator (such as `;`, `|`, `&&`)
 | 
						|
  before a newline will incorrectly be highlighted as an error.  See issue #677
 | 
						|
  for examples and workarounds.
 | 
						|
  [#677]

# Changes in version 0.5.0
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
## Performance improvements: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
We thank Sebastian Gniazdowski and "m0viefreak" for significant contributions
 | 
						|
in this area.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Optimize string operations in the `main` (default) highlighter.
 | 
						|
  (#372/3cb58fd7d7b9, 02229ebd6328, ef4bfe5bcc14, #372/c6b6513ac0d6, #374/15461e7d21c3)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command word highlighting:  Use the `zsh/parameter` module to avoid forks.
 | 
						|
  Memoize (cache) the results.
 | 
						|
  (#298, 3ce01076b521, 2f18ba64e397, 12b879caf7a6; #320, 3b67e656bff5)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Avoid forks in the driver and in the `root` highlighter.
 | 
						|
  (b9112aec798a, 38c8fbea2dd2)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
## Added highlighting of: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- `pkexec` (a precommand).
 | 
						|
  (#248, 4f3910cbbaa5)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Aliases that cannot be defined normally nor invoked normally (highlighted as an error).
 | 
						|
  (#263 (in part), 28932316cca6)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Path separators (`/`) — the default behaviour remains to highlight path separators
 | 
						|
  and path components the same way.
 | 
						|
  (#136, #260, 6cd39e7c70d3, 9a934d291e7c, f3d3aaa00cc4)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Assignments to individual positional arguments (`42=foo` to assign to `$42`).
 | 
						|
  (f4036a09cee3)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Linewise region (the `visual-line-mode` widget, bound to `V` in zsh's `vi` keymap).
 | 
						|
  (#267, a7a7f8b42280, ee07588cfd9b)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command-lines recalled by `isearch` mode; requires zsh≥5.3.
 | 
						|
  (#261 (in part); #257; 4ad311ec0a68)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command-lines whilst the `IGNORE_BRACES` or `IGNORE_CLOSE_BRACES` option is in effect.
 | 
						|
  (a8a6384356af, 02807f1826a5)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Mismatched parentheses and braces (in the `main` highlighter).
 | 
						|
  (51b9d79c3bb6, 2fabf7ca64b7, a4196eda5e6f, and others)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Mismatched `do`/`done` keywords.
 | 
						|
  (b2733a64da93)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Mismatched `foreach`/`end` keywords.
 | 
						|
  (#96, 2bb8f0703d8f)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- In Bourne-style function definitions, when the `MULTI_FUNC_DEF` option is set
 | 
						|
  (which is the default), highlight the first word in the function body as
 | 
						|
  a command word: `f() { g "$@" }`.
 | 
						|
  (6f91850a01e1)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- `always` blocks.
 | 
						|
  (#335, e5782e4ddfb6)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command substitutions inside double quotes, `"$(echo foo)"`.
 | 
						|
  (#139 (in part), c3913e0d8ead)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Non-alphabetic parameters inside double quotes (`"$$"`, `"$#"`, `"$*"`, `"$@"`, `"$?"`, `"$-"`).
 | 
						|
  (4afe670f7a1b, 44ef6e38e5a7)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command words from future versions of zsh (forward compatibly).
 | 
						|
  This also adds an `arg0` style that all other command word styles fall back to.
 | 
						|
  (b4537a972eed, bccc3dc26943)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Escaped history expansions inside double quotes: `: "\!"`
 | 
						|
  (28d7056a7a06, et seq)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
## Fixed highlighting of: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command separator tokens in syntactically-invalid positions.
 | 
						|
  (09c4114eb980)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Redirections with a file descriptor number at command word.
 | 
						|
  (#238 (in part), 73ee7c1f6c4a)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- The `select` prompt, `$PS3`.
 | 
						|
  (#268, 451665cb2a8b)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Values of variables in `vared`.
 | 
						|
  (e500ca246286)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- `!` as an argument (neither a history expansion nor a reserved word).
 | 
						|
  (4c23a2fd1b90)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- "division by zero" error under the `brackets` highlighter when `$ZSH_HIGHLIGHT_STYLES` is empty.
 | 
						|
  (f73f3d53d3a6)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Process substitutions, `<(pwd)` and `>(wc -l)`.
 | 
						|
  (#302, 6889ff6bd2ad, bfabffbf975c, fc9c892a3f15)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- The non-`SHORT_LOOPS` form of `repeat` loops: `repeat 42; do true; done`.
 | 
						|
  (#290, 4832f18c50a5, ef68f50c048f, 6362c757b6f7)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Broken symlinks (are now highlighted as files).
 | 
						|
  (#342, 95f7206a9373, 53083da8215e)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Lines accepted from `isearch` mode.
 | 
						|
  (#284; #257, #259, #288; 5bae6219008b, a8fe22d42251)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Work around upstream bug that triggered when the command word was a relative
 | 
						|
  path, that when interpreted relative to a $PATH directory denoted a command;
 | 
						|
  the effect of that upstream bug was that the relative path was cached as
 | 
						|
  a "valid external command name".
 | 
						|
  (#354, #355, 51614ca2c994, fdaeec45146b, 7d38d07255e4;
 | 
						|
  upstream fix slated to be released in 5.3 (workers/39104))
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- After accepting a line with the cursor on a bracket, the matching bracket
 | 
						|
  of the bracket under the cursor no longer remains highlighted (with the
 | 
						|
  `brackets` highlighter).
 | 
						|
  (4c4baede519a)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- The first word on a new line within an array assignment or initialization is no
 | 
						|
  longer considered a command position.
 | 
						|
  (8bf423d16d46)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Subshells that end at command position, `(A=42)`, `(true;)`.
 | 
						|
  (#231, 7fb6f9979121; #344, 4fc35362ee5a)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- Command word after array assignment, `a=(lorem ipsum) pwd`.
 | 
						|
  (#330, 7fb6f9979121)
 | 
						|
 |

# Changes in version 0.4.0
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
## Added highlighting of: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- incomplete sudo commands
 | 
						|
  (a3047a912100, 2f05620b19ae)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    sudo;
 | 
						|
    sudo -u;
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- command words following reserved words
 | 
						|
  (#207, #222, b397b12ac139 et seq, 6fbd2aa9579b et seq, 8b4adbd991b0)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    if ls; then ls; else ls; fi
 | 
						|
    repeat 10 do ls; done
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    (The `ls` are now highlighted as a command.)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- comments (when `INTERACTIVE_COMMENTS` is set)
 | 
						|
  (#163, #167, 693de99a9030)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    echo Hello # comment
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- closing brackets of arithmetic expansion, subshells, and blocks
 | 
						|
  (#226, a59f442d2d34, et seq)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    (( foo ))
 | 
						|
    ( foo )
 | 
						|
    { foo }
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- command names enabled by the `PATH_DIRS` option
 | 
						|
  (#228, 96ee5116b182)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    # When ~/bin/foo/bar exists, is executable, ~/bin is in $PATH,
 | 
						|
    # and 'setopt PATH_DIRS' is in effect
 | 
						|
    foo/bar
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- parameter expansions with braces inside double quotes
 | 
						|
  (#186, 6e3720f39d84)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    echo "${foo}"
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- parameter expansions in command word
 | 
						|
  (#101, 4fcfb15913a2)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    x=/bin/ls
 | 
						|
    $x -l
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- the command separators '\|&', '&!', '&\|'
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    view file.pdf &!  ls
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
## Fixed highlighting of: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- precommand modifiers at non-command-word position
 | 
						|
  (#209, 2c9f8c8c95fa)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    ls command foo
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- sudo commands with infix redirections
 | 
						|
  (#221, be006aded590, 86e924970911)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    sudo -u >/tmp/foo.out user ls
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- subshells; anonymous functions
 | 
						|
  (#166, #194, 0d1bfbcbfa67, 9e178f9f3948)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    (true)
 | 
						|
    () { true }
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- parameter assignment statements with no command
 | 
						|
  (#205, 01d7eeb3c713)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    ```zsh
 | 
						|
    A=1;
 | 
						|
    ```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    (The semicolon used to be highlighted as a mistake)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- cursor highlighter: Remove the cursor highlighting when accepting a line.
 | 
						|
  (#109, 4f0c293fdef0)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
